You can listen to your "gut" while you are experimenting with wine. If you already know that you can't stand Merlot, don't buy a bottle just because someone gave it a good review. This will only make you waste your money on something that will take a seat on your shelf.

Have you ever spilled wine on your clothes? If so, find a bottle of Windex. You will definately get better is a result of Windex than from soap and water. Spray it on as soon as you can, because waiting allows the stain to set, making it more difficult to eradicate.

Look for an online forum you can join. These forums are a fun way to become familiar with a lot about wine, as well as making new friends. Prior to joining a board, read some of the posts to see if it's a good fit.

Take wine advice carefully. Anyone that's really good at their business in regards to wine knows that they may fail sometimes. They also know their tastes will differ from those of others. Do not place their word as gospel.

It is important to know how to peel a wine bottle label off. An easy way to ensure you can remove the entire label without ripping it is to heat it in the oven until you can easily peel off the label.

Go to where the wine is. To appreciate the various grape flavors, you must see how and where they're harvested. This will help you immensely in your understanding of various wines. In addition, you will enjoy the scenery during your trip!
